Jerry A. Pattengale (born 1958) is a faculty member and administrator at Indiana Wesleyan University.[1] He coined and founded the approach of “purpose-guided education” in 1997 while leading the implementation of student success programs at Indiana Wesleyan University.[2][3][4][5] His approach includes calling for a humanities approach to student success,[6] and the need for faculty involvement in the development of strategies.[7]
In 2007 and 2008, he participated in Roundtable meetings at the White House on compassion efforts through OFBCI.[8] In 2020, he spoke at the United Nations (NYC) as part of the UN’s Plan of Action to Safeguard Religious Sites.[citation needed] From 2010 to 2014, he served as the Executive Director of the Green Scholars Initiative[9] while researching historic items in the Green Collection.[10]
Pattengale was one of the two founding scholars and leaders (2010) of the Museum of the Bible, which opened in Washington, D.C. in November 2017,[11] and served as the museum's Executive Director of Education until retiring in 2018.[12] In the spring of 2020 he returned as Senior Advisor to the President.
In 2019-2020 he served as the interim president and CEO for Religion News Service and the Religion News Foundation.[13] He co-authored the six-episode TV docuseries (and book), Inexplicable: How Christianity Spread to the Ends of the Earth (TBN, 2020, hosted by Dennis Haysbert).[14]
